Output 80ebed432797963a95e1a19f0fda37fc5603ac09810d22b72f08117311359957:0

value
61085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f77b57b2e5853ad8e70b2a195c16b3f885724a OP_EQUAL
address
3D5nBfhpzs3aR9hcUK4onz45iQ4RVHc16U
transaction
80ebed432797963a95e1a19f0fda37fc5603ac09810d22b72f08117311359957
confirmations
100272
spent
true